Aidagulov", "Max A. Alekseyev" ], "categories": [ "math.NT", "math.CO" ], "abstract": "We propose higher-order generalizations of Jacobsthal's p-adic approximation for binomial coefficients. Our results imply explicit formulae for linear combinations of binomial coefficients $\\binom{ip}{p}$ (i=1,2,...) that are divisible by arbitrarily large powers of prime p.", "revisions": [ { "version": "v1", "updated": "2016-02-08T16:20:24.000Z" } ], "analyses": { "subjects": [ "05A10", "11A07", "11B65" ], "keywords": [ "binomial coefficients", "results imply explicit formulae", "jacobsthals p-adic approximation", "higher-order generalizations", "linear combinations" ], "note": { "typesetting": "TeX", "pages": 0, "language": "en", "license": "arXiv", "status": "editable" } } }
